Latest revision as of 13:32, 29 November 2023

Any process that results in a change in state or activity of a cell (in terms of movement, secretion, enzyme production, gene expression, etc.) as a result of a triglyceride stimulus.
  • GO:0071401
  • cellular response to triacylglyceride
  • cellular response to triacylglycerol
